New Showbiz Analysis

Spaghetti at Midnight is a genre-driven farce that emphasizes social dysfunction over diverse representation. The plot relies on traditional infidelity clichés and the clash between different social classes, such as the bourgeoisie and organized crime. While the film avoids promoting idealized family values by highlighting chaos and moral ambiguity, it lacks intentionality regarding underrepresented identities. The narrative's energy comes from disrupting social order rather than inclusive storytelling. Ultimately, the film adheres to the stylistic conventions of 1980s Italian genre cinema, focusing on situational ethics and comedic mishaps rather than diverse character perspectives.

Official Synopsis

Savino La Gastra discovers his wife Celeste has a liaison with an architect: Andrea. Even if also Savino has a story with Elvira, a judge's wife, he decides anyway to ask to a mobster to kill his wife. In the mean time Celeste is organizing a surprise party for Savino's birthday, and that day things start to get complicated. First Savino kills accidentally the mafia killer in charge to kill Celeste; second his lover Elvira arrives to the party with the judge... not to mention the police and the mafia Don...
